Question
evaluate $\log_{12}y^2$, given $\log_{12}y = 16$.
\\(\circ\\) 4
\\(\circ\\) 32
\\(\circ\\) 256
\\(\circ\\) 65,536
Step1: Recall logarithm power rule
The power rule of logarithms states that $\log_b a^n = n\log_b a$.
Step2: Apply the power rule to $\log_{12} y^2$
Using the power rule, we can rewrite $\log_{12} y^2$ as $2\log_{12} y$.
Step3: Substitute the given value
We know that $\log_{12} y = 16$, so substitute this into the expression: $2\times16 = 32$.
